A 32-year-old man with two children requests vasectomy. He asks whether reversal is easy if he changes his mind. What would you advise this patient?

Correct answer: EVasectomy should be regarded as permanent

Vasectomy should be counselled as permanent even though reversal may sometimes be attempted privately. Partner involvement may be helpful but partner consent is not required. Condoms are still needed for STI prevention.
